Factors to Consider When Choosing Squishy Toys

You’ll want to pick a squishy that’s safe, portable, and built to last, so check for non-toxic, BPA-free materials and a soft yet durable PU exterior. Think about size-most users prefer 2.5 to 4 inches for easy pocket carry-and go for designs like animals or food that add a fun touch without sacrificing squish quality. Always match the toy to the user’s age: simpler, larger squishies work better for little kids, while older teens and adults might enjoy intricate textures or collectible sets that hold up after daily use.

Safety And Materials

Though safety might not be the first thing on your mind when picking a squishy toy, it’s the most critical factor, especially if kids or sensitive users are involved. You should always check that the toy is made from non-toxic materials like TPR or food-grade silicone, which are safe even if accidentally handled by little ones. Look for compliance with ASTM F963 or CPSC standards-they guarantee no harmful chemicals or small, detachable parts. Avoid any squishy with a strong plastic smell; that could mean VOCs or phthalates, which aren’t safe with long-term contact. Pick smooth, seamless designs to prevent skin irritation or choking hazards, especially for children under 3. Go for latex-free, hypoallergenic options if you or your child has sensitivities-these tested well in allergy clinics and parent trials.

Durability And Care

Though softness and design often grab your attention first, the long-term performance of a squishy toy hinges on durable materials and proper care. You’ll want squishies made from TPR (thermoplastic rubber)-they’re stretchable, tear-resistant, and hold their shape even after hundreds of squeezes. Top-performing models bounce back to their original form in 5–10 seconds, maintaining that satisfying slow-rise feel over time. To keep them fresh, clean yours gently with water and mild soap, then dust with baby powder to prevent stickiness and restore that plush texture. Avoid leaving them in direct sunlight or hot cars-prolonged heat can warp shapes, fade colors, or break down the material. For best results, store your squishy in a cool, dry spot, ideally in a sealed bag or container to block dust and dirt. With the right care, your favorite squishy stays soft, springy, and satisfying for months.

Can I Microwave Squishy Toys?

you shouldn’t microwave squishy toys-they’re not built to handle heat and could melt, leak, or even catch fire. most are made from polyurethane foam or silicone filled with non-toxic but heat-sensitive gel or beads. testers found even 10 seconds caused warping in cheaper models. always check manufacturer guidelines, but assume microwaving isn’t safe. if you want warm sensory relief, use a heating pad wrapped in cloth instead-it’s controlled, safe, and effective without risking damage or injury.
